Band participated in the Fort Hays Music Festival on April 19. They received straight I ratings from all three judges.
“We performed ‘King Cotton’ concert march by John Phillips Sousa and the first three movements of ‘Puszta’ (gypsy dances) by Jan van der Roost,” band director Craig Manteuffel said. “This is very difficult music and we performed well.”
Students this year found the straight I ratings to be a little surprising, but feel that towards the end, it all came together.
“I think we did okay this year,” senior Torrey Contrerez said. “I was surprised by the straight I ratings.”
This will make it the 8th year in a row to receive one ratings at state large groups. In the 16 years that Manteuffel has been at Hays High, 15 of them the band has received I ratings.
